Are you noticing cracks or uneven surfaces on your driveway? These issues are common in many homes in this area due to the distinctive environmental patterns experienced around Bethany Beach. Coastal locations like this are prone to varying moisture levels, particularly during rainy seasons. The ground can become saturated, leading to soil settlement and erosion beneath your driveway. Coastal sandy soils can shift more easily when exposed to water. Over time, extremes in temperature and moisture levels cause the ground to expand and contract, affecting the stability of driveways and leading to visible surface flaws.
These local conditions can put stress on your driveway as the supporting soil undergoes constant movement. Cracks and shifts in your driveway may indicate underlying soil problems, pooling water, or uneven foundations. These are signs that should not be overlooked; early detection can help address minor problems before they evolve into major repairs. By understanding the regional challenges—including high groundwater levels and fluctuating moisture—you can better maintain the integrity of your driveway. Paying attention to warning signs such as new cracks or sunken sections can help prevent further damage, maintaining safety and curb appeal for your property.
